Bill’s Bullpen in Hollister is one of thousands of comic book shops around the world celebrating the comic book art form on Saturday, May 7. On this day, more than two million comic books will be given away by participating stores, introducing as many people as possible to the wonders of comic books.

“The wide array of comic books being published today ensures that readers of all ages — children, teens, and adults – can find something appropriate that will stir their imaginations,” said Bill Mifsud, owner of Bill’s Bullpen on the corner of Fourth and East streets.

Now in its 15th year, Free Comic Book Day has proven to be a smashing success, spreading the word that comics are terrific reading. “Even if you have never picked up a comic book, stop into Bill’s Bullpen, because you never know what you will end up finding.”
